Cyrela Brazil Realty S.A. Empreendimentos e Participações (CYRBY)
OTCMKTS · Delayed Price · Currency is USD
6.99
+0.69 (10.95%)
Feb 12, 2026, 2:51 PM EST

CYRBY Ratios and Metrics

Millions USD. Fiscal year is Jan - Dec.
Fiscal Year
CurrentFY 2024FY 2023FY 2022FY 2021FY 2020
Period Ending
Feb '26 Dec '24 Dec '23 Dec '22 Dec '21 Dec '20
2,2099841,8619371,0892,183
Market Cap Growth
86.38%-47.09%98.58%-13.96%-50.11%-23.13%
Enterprise Value
3,0921,5362,4851,3801,3762,344
Last Close Price
7.002.534.272.182.424.39
PE Ratio
6.463.699.586.126.646.44
PS Ratio
1.350.761.440.921.273.00
PB Ratio
1.020.611.060.640.891.96
P/TBV Ratio
1.140.701.200.720.982.07
P/FCF Ratio
-----6.89
P/OCF Ratio
-95.95---6.62
EV/Sales Ratio
1.841.191.931.351.603.22
EV/EBITDA Ratio
8.196.9713.4311.699.3423.58
EV/EBIT Ratio
8.407.2314.2112.579.8225.34
EV/FCF Ratio
-34.58----7.40
Debt / Equity Ratio
0.670.610.610.650.530.47
Debt / EBITDA Ratio
5.414.485.747.954.425.15
Debt / FCF Ratio
-----1.64
Net Debt / Equity Ratio
0.310.310.300.270.170.15
Net Debt / EBITDA Ratio
2.482.242.803.371.371.67
Net Debt / FCF Ratio
-7.40-38.89-3.39-4.19-2.410.52
Asset Turnover
0.390.410.370.360.380.35
Inventory Turnover
1.191.271.121.001.010.95
Quick Ratio
1.981.831.611.361.661.53
Current Ratio
3.513.272.832.483.112.88
Return on Equity (ROE)
20.09%20.82%13.65%11.84%16.15%33.35%
Return on Assets (ROA)
3.87%4.26%3.13%2.39%3.86%2.80%
Return on Invested Capital (ROIC)
8.46%9.99%7.14%5.73%9.86%5.92%
Return on Capital Employed (ROCE)
6.60%7.50%6.10%4.50%6.90%5.10%
Earnings Yield
15.47%27.09%10.44%16.33%15.07%15.53%
FCF Yield
-4.05%-1.29%-8.20%-10.14%-7.67%14.52%
Dividend Yield
8.71%6.84%-4.43%-11.60%
Payout Ratio
12.29%13.57%33.66%3.09%21.97%34.09%
Buyback Yield / Dilution
3.96%2.24%0.21%2.28%0.00%-0.02%
Total Shareholder Return
12.66%9.08%0.21%6.72%-11.58%
Source: S&P Global Market Intelligence. Standard template. Financial Sources.